what would most likely happen to the carbon cycle if there were no more plants on earth? animals would consume more carbon. more carbon would be released from fossil fuels. carbon would build up in the atmosphere. animals would perform more photosynthesis.
Plants play a crucial role in the carbon - cycle by taking in carbon dioxide for photosynthesis. Without plants, there would be no mechanism to remove carbon dioxide from the atmosphere through photosynthesis. Animals do not perform photosynthesis, and the release of carbon from fossil fuels is not related to the absence of plants in terms of the immediate impact on the carbon - cycle. So carbon would build up in the atmosphere.
